Short answer
In Europe, Latin America, and most of Asia, a current resume photo helps. In the US, UK, and Canada, usually skip it.

Résumé and CV norms
Some markets discourage photos on CVs — follow local practice.
Where photos are expected, use the same clean image on the CV and LinkedIn for consistency.

Quick checklist
- Check the local norm before adding a photo to your CV.
- Conservative background, tight crop, natural expression.
- Same photo on the resume and LinkedIn — consistency builds trust.
- Use natural light and center your face in the selfie.
